Uzbek MMA fighter Mahmud Murodov, competing in the middleweight division of Oktagon MMA, has issued a firm challenge to his potential opponents: if they want to fight him, they must stick to 84kg. He made the statement during an interview with the promotion’s press service.
Murodov emphasized that he will not move to other weight categories, stating:
"My opponent wants to fight at 77kg, but I won’t drop down. I won’t go up to 93kg either. If anyone wants to face me in the octagon, they need to meet the 84kg requirement. Fleuri challenged me at 93kg, but I won’t change my weight."
Murodov is set to enter the octagon on June 14 at Oktagon 72, where he will face Czech fighter Patrik Kinsl.
Fighter Records:
- Mahmud Murodov (35 years old) – 36 fights: 28 wins, 8 losses
- Patrik Kinsl – 28 wins, 11 losses
